SPIP CMS < 3.2.14 Multiples Vulnerabilities

Description

According to its self-reported version, the instance of SPIP CMS running on the remote web server is prior to 3.2.14 or 4.0.x prior to 4.0.5. It is, therefore, affected by multiples vulnerabilities :
- A Remote Code Execution
- Unauthenticated access to information about editorial objects.

Note that the scanner has not tested for these issues but has instead relied only on the application's self-reported version number

Solution

Update to SPIP CMS version 3.2.14 or latest.
